British snack brand Popcorn Kitchen has expanded its portfolio with a new savoury line, Crunch Corn, available now in three flavours.


Made from Peruvian Choclo giant corn, the snacks aim to deliver a ‘satisfying crunch’ and innovative, premium alternative to the smaller, commonly used sweet corn kernels in savoury corn snack products.


The HFSS-compliant treats are rich in fibre and debut in three flavour varieties, Sea Salt, Salt & Vinegar and Spicy Chilli, available in 100g sharing bags and 30g snack bags. The team said these Mediterranean-inspired snacks provide an alternative to increasingly expensive premium nuts and seeds.


Popcorn Kitchen’s founder, Louise Monk, said she was inspired to create the new range following a trip to the Seville Food Fair in Spain, in 2023. Here, she was introduced to seasoned, roasted giant corn kernels as a snack, and decided on Choclo giant corn as the perfect foundation for her own bold flavoured range.


“We cooked up Crunch Corn because we wanted to create a more complete savoury treat for those underwhelmed by potato crisps and frustrated by spiralling costs of allergy-risking nuts and seeds,” Monk said.


“As corn obsessives already well-versed in popcorn happiness, we felt now was the perfect moment to share new crunchy joy”.
